Episode Summary
Sergei Mishnev's survival leads to a terror attack at a global summit, drawing NCIS into a high-stakes investigation. Tensions rise with Russian connections and internal struggles, notably Tobias Fornell grappling with personal demons. The episode intensifies with Gibbs and Fornell confronting Sergei in a climactic showdown, providing emotional closure for Fornell over Diane's death. The episode blends action with deep character exploration, culminating in a poignant resolution.
